Move-in is a great time to pack your stuff and consider what you want to bring to the university.

That also makes it a great time to consider taking some small steps toward sustainability while moving.

Put your recyclable materials in the right place. Inside of every residence hall, there are recycling bins where you can dispose of things properly

Bring your own water bottle. You’ll find bottle refilling stations all over in campus buildings. Don’t buy bottled water. Bring your own and refill anytime you need a cool drink.

Use paper decorations for your room. That way you can recycle them at the end of the spring semester. You don’t need a printer because you can go to the Arkansas Union or other places on campus to print.
